What Information Is Needed for a Bespoke Lighting Quotation?

A bespoke lighting quotation depends on more than the appearance of the fixture. Clear information about dimensions, materials, quantities, electrical requirements and installation conditions allows the manufacturer to assess the design accurately.

A bespoke lighting enquiry may begin with a detailed drawing, a rendering, a reference photograph or simply an initial design idea.

It is not always necessary to have a complete technical package before contacting a manufacturer. However, the quality of the available information directly affects the accuracy of the quotation.

A reference image may communicate the intended appearance, but it does not confirm the size, construction, materials, light source or installation method. When these details are missing, a quotation may need to rely on assumptions that could change later.

Providing the right information at the beginning allows the manufacturer to understand the design, identify technical questions and prepare a more reliable proposal.

1. Reference Images or Design Drawings

The first requirement is a clear visual reference showing what needs to be produced.

This may include:

  • A hand sketch
  • A reference photograph
  • An interior rendering
  • A PDF drawing
  • A CAD drawing
  • A 3D model
  • A lighting schedule
  • A specification sheet

The information does not need to be presented in a particular format at the initial enquiry stage. A clear image and basic dimensions may be enough to begin a preliminary review.

However, it is important to explain whether the image represents:

  • The exact design to be manufactured
  • A general style reference
  • A finish reference
  • A shape or proportion reference
  • An existing product that needs to be adapted

This helps the manufacturer understand which details should remain unchanged and which can be developed.

2. Overall Dimensions

The overall size of the fixture is one of the most important factors in a bespoke lighting quotation.

Depending on the product, useful dimensions may include:

  • Diameter
  • Width
  • Length
  • Body height
  • Overall height
  • Overall drop
  • Projection from the wall
  • Ceiling plate dimensions
  • Backplate dimensions
  • Suspension length

A decorative pendant measuring 400 mm in diameter will require a different amount of material and a different internal structure from a chandelier measuring 2,000 mm in diameter, even if the visual concept is similar.

For suspended lighting, it is helpful to distinguish between the height of the fixture body and the total suspension height.

Where dimensions have not yet been finalised, an approximate size range can still support an initial review. The quotation should then clearly state which dimensions have been assumed.

3. Quantity

Quantity affects more than the total price.

It can influence:

  • Material purchasing
  • Component sourcing
  • Tooling or mould costs
  • Production methods
  • Sample requirements
  • Unit pricing
  • Packaging
  • Production time

A one-off decorative fixture may require the same technical development as a larger quantity, but the development cost is distributed differently.

If the project includes several sizes or variations of the same design, provide the quantity for each version separately.

For example:

  • 20 wall lights
  • 8 table lamps
  • 4 large pendants
  • 12 small pendants

This is more useful than providing only the combined project quantity.

4. Materials

If the intended material is known, it should be included with the enquiry.

Typical decorative lighting materials may include:

  • Brass
  • Stainless steel
  • Steel
  • Aluminium
  • Glass
  • Resin
  • Fabric
  • Timber
  • Stone or stone-effect materials

The visible appearance alone may not confirm the correct base material.

A brass-coloured component, for example, could be manufactured from solid brass, stainless steel with a plated finish, aluminium or another suitable material. These options can differ significantly in weight, construction, appearance and cost.

If the material is not fixed, explain the required visual result and ask the manufacturer to recommend a suitable option.

5. Finish Requirements

Finish descriptions should be as specific as possible.

Examples include:

  • Brushed brass
  • Antique brass
  • Satin nickel
  • Brushed bronze
  • Polished chrome
  • Matt black
  • Powder-coated finish
  • Painted RAL colour

A written finish name can still be interpreted differently by different suppliers. Where appearance is important, it is useful to provide:

  • A finish sample
  • A physical reference
  • A clear photograph
  • A RAL code
  • An approved finish from a previous order

The final finish should normally be confirmed by an approved sample rather than relying only on a screen image.

Natural variation may also need to be considered when working with hand-applied finishes, timber, stone, handmade glass or other materials with individual characteristics.

6. Light Source

The quotation should identify the preferred light source where possible.

This may include:

  • Replaceable E14 or E27 lamps
  • G9 or G4 lamps
  • Integrated LED modules
  • LED strips
  • COB LED
  • Decorative filament lamps

The choice of light source affects the internal construction, heat management, diffuser position, maintenance access and electrical components.

For integrated LED products, useful information includes:

  • Required wattage
  • Colour temperature
  • Lumen output
  • Colour rendering requirement
  • Beam angle, where relevant
  • Replaceability or access requirement

If these details have not yet been confirmed, the manufacturer can review the fixture and propose a suitable starting point.

7. Colour Temperature

Colour temperature has a significant effect on the appearance of decorative lighting.

Common requirements include:

  • 2200K
  • 2400K
  • 2700K
  • 3000K
  • 4000K

For hospitality interiors, warmer colour temperatures are often selected, but the correct choice depends on the interior concept and lighting specification.

The same colour temperature should ideally be coordinated across the project, particularly when bespoke fixtures are installed close to architectural lighting.

8. Dimming and Control

Dimming requirements should be confirmed before the electrical design is finalised.

Possible control methods include:

  • Non-dimmable
  • Phase dimming
  • TRIAC dimming
  • 0–10V or 1–10V
  • DALI
  • DALI-2
  • Push dimming
  • A project-specific control system

The control method affects the driver specification, internal space and wiring arrangement.

A driver selected for one dimming system may not be suitable for another. Changing the dimming requirement after production has started can therefore affect cost, construction and delivery time.

If the project uses DALI or another control system, it is also useful to clarify whether the driver will be installed inside the fixture, inside the ceiling plate or remotely.

9. Voltage and Project Location

The project location helps the manufacturer understand the electrical and installation requirements.

Useful information includes:

  • Destination country
  • Input voltage
  • Frequency
  • Plug type for portable fixtures
  • Applicable project requirements
  • Indoor or outdoor use

A table lamp intended for the UK may require a different plug and cable arrangement from one intended for Europe or the United States.

The project location may also affect packaging, documentation, transportation and delivery planning.

Any required testing, documentation or compliance standard should be identified during the quotation stage rather than assumed.

10. Installation Conditions

A lighting fixture cannot be reviewed independently from the surface or structure supporting it.

For ceiling-mounted products, useful information may include:

  • Ceiling type
  • Ceiling void depth
  • Fixing surface
  • Suspension height
  • Available cable entry
  • Driver location
  • Access above the ceiling
  • Maximum permitted weight
  • Number of available fixing points

For wall lights, useful information may include:

  • Wall construction
  • Recess depth
  • Electrical box position
  • Cable entry point
  • Backplate limitations
  • Surface-mounted or recessed installation

For large chandeliers, the manufacturer may also need information about ceiling access, lifting, on-site assembly and structural support.

If the final site condition is not yet available, this should be identified as an item requiring confirmation.

11. Required IP Rating

The required IP rating depends on where the fixture will be installed.

A decorative light used in a dry interior may have different construction requirements from a fixture used in a bathroom, sheltered exterior or fully exposed outdoor location.

If an IP rating is required, provide:

  • The required rating
  • The intended location
  • Whether the fixture is exposed to direct water
  • Any project-specific testing requirement

It is better to provide the installation condition rather than requesting an IP rating based only on appearance.

12. Programme and Delivery Requirements

The required delivery date should be shared as early as possible.

A bespoke lighting programme may include:

  1. Design review
  2. Initial quotation
  3. Production shop drawings
  4. Finish or material samples
  5. Prototype development
  6. Sample approval
  7. Material purchasing
  8. Production
  9. Quality inspection
  10. Packaging
  11. Transportation

The production time should not be considered separately from drawing approval, sampling and shipping.

If the project has a fixed installation date, the quotation request should include both the required delivery date and the destination.

This allows the manufacturer to assess whether the programme is realistic before the order proceeds.

13. Packaging and Shipping

Large, fragile or complex fixtures may require specially designed packaging.

The manufacturer may need to consider:

  • Wooden cases
  • Protective foam
  • Separate packaging for glass
  • Modular construction
  • On-site assembly
  • Maximum carton dimensions
  • Air freight or sea freight limitations

Packaging can influence how the fixture is divided into sections and assembled on site.

For very large lighting installations, transportation should therefore be considered during product development rather than after production is complete.

What If Some Information Is Missing?

It is normal for some details to remain unresolved during the first enquiry.

A manufacturer can still review the available information and identify what needs to be confirmed before a firm quotation is issued.

Where assumptions are necessary, they should be stated clearly.

For example:

  • Quotation based on the dimensions shown in the reference drawing
  • Finish based on brushed brass, subject to sample approval
  • Non-dimmable driver assumed
  • Standard suspension length assumed
  • Installation hardware excluded pending ceiling details

This allows the project to move forward without presenting estimates as confirmed specifications.

A preliminary quotation can be useful during budgeting, but the price may need to be revised once the final dimensions, materials and electrical requirements are approved.

A Practical Enquiry Checklist

Before submitting a bespoke lighting enquiry, provide as much of the following information as possible:

  • Reference image or drawing
  • Overall dimensions
  • Quantity for each design
  • Preferred material
  • Finish requirement
  • Light source
  • Colour temperature
  • Dimming or control method
  • Voltage
  • Project location
  • Installation condition
  • Required IP rating
  • Required delivery date
  • Relevant project documents

The enquiry does not need to be perfect. What matters is that confirmed information, provisional information and open questions are clearly distinguished.
